DeleteObject

Family: 3D · One form

What it does

DeleteObject removes a 3D object: after it, the id names nothing. It takes objectID (an integer), and returns nothing. objectID is the id of a 3D object, the one LoadObject returned: it is how the call knows what to act on.

Example · generated

object = LoadObject("assets/media.obj")DeleteObject(object)DO  Sync()LOOP

LoadObject is there to give the call something to act on; DeleteObject is the line that matters. The DO … LOOP is not decoration: a classic BASIC program ends the moment it runs out of lines, and Sync() is what draws the frame.
